Moderate to Severe Rheumatoid Arthritis Overview

Moderate to severe rheumatoid arthritis is a chronic autoimmune disorder in which persistent inflammation of the synovial lining leads to progressive joint damage, pain, stiffness, swelling, and functional disability, often accompanied by systemic complications such as cardiovascular disease, lung involvement, and fatigue. At these stages, patients experience significant impairment in daily activities, with disease activity measured through composite scores and biomarkers like rheumatoid factor and anti‑CCP antibodies. Management requires early, aggressive therapy with disease‑modifying antirheumatic drugs (DMARDs) such as methotrexate, often combined with biologic or targeted synthetic agents including TNF inhibitors, IL‑6 receptor blockers, or JAK inhibitors, while corticosteroids and NSAIDs provide symptomatic relief. Despite advances, many patients continue to face flares and progression, underscoring the need for personalized treatment strategies, vigilant monitoring, and innovation in targeted therapies to preserve joint function, reduce systemic risks, and improve long‑term outcomes.
